Accepted Insurance Plans
OHSU accepts hundreds of insurance plans, including original Medicare, also called traditional Medicare.
Some plans may limit what they'll cover at OHSU, so it's best to check with your insurer before getting care.
A partial list of insurance plans accepted by OHSU includes:
- Aetna
- AllCare
- CareOregon
- Cigna
- Eastern Oregon CCO
- Emerging Therapy Solutions (LifeTrac)
- First Choice Health
- Health Net
- Humana
- InterLink Transplant Network
- Kaiser Permanente National Transplant Services
- Kaiser Oregon/SW Washington
- Kaiser Washington
- Moda
- Molina Healthcare
- MultiPlan
- OHSU Health Services/OHSU Health IDS
- Optum/UnitedHealthcare/United Behavioral Health
- PacificSource
- Providence Health Plan
- Regence BlueCross BlueShield
- Samaritan Health Plans
- Trillium Community Health Plan
- TriWest HealthCare Alliance
- Yamhill Community Care
Additionally, OHSU accepts most dental insurance plans, including Oregon State Medicaid/Oregon Health Plan and Washington State Medicaid/Apple Health.

Frequently Asked Questions
What hospitals are affiliated with OHSU?
OHSU is affiliated with several hospitals, including Doernbecher Children's Hospital, Legacy Good Samaritan Medical Center, and Legacy Silverton Hospital, among others. For a comprehensive list, visit the OHSU website.
Does OHSU take Washington State insurance?
Yes, OHSU Dental Clinics accepts Washington State Medicaid/Apple Health plans, as well as most private insurance plans, including Blue Cross Blue Shield.
Does OHSU take the Oregon Health Plan?
Yes, OHSU accepts the Oregon Health Plan (OHP) as a form of insurance. Learn more about how OHP and OHSU work together to meet your health care needs.
